Abstract: the present study aimedat investigating the role of public and private schools in the development of iq among elementary students. It was necessarily a descriptive research in nature that was conducted among the 56 elementary students of two selected public and private schools in a metropolitan area of pakistan.

An intelligence quotient (iq) is a total score derived from a set of standardized tests or subtests designed to assess human intelligence. The abbreviation iq was coined by the psychologist william stern for the german term intelligenzquotient, his term for a scoring method for intelligence tests at university of breslau he advocated in a 1912 book.
